Proceedings of the 2016 5th International Conference on Measurement, Instrumentation and Automation (ICMIA 2016)

An Automated Testing Method for UDS Protocol Stack of Vehicles

Authors
Jinghua Yu, Feng Luo
Corresponding Author
Jinghua Yu
Available Online November 2016.
DOI
10.2991/icmia-16.2016.113How to use a DOI?
Keywords
Diagnostic Protocol Stack, Orthogonal Design Method, ODX Database, Automated Testing.
Abstract

An automated testing method for vehicles' UDS (Unified Diagnostic Service) protocol stack [1] based on CAN bus is presented in this article. According to different diagnostic services, which are specified in ISO 14229-1, a strategy of generating test cases is designed by using a comprehensive method, which is mainly based on orthogonal design method. Then a test tool is developed in Delphi development environment. It can configure test parameters, import standard ODX (Open Diagnostic Data Exchange) database files and generate test scripts automatically. Finally, these scripts can be executed in another test environment directly and get test reports automatically. During the whole test process, users do not need to study the details of the test specification and write test scripts, or do the test steps manually. They can test the target stack just by configuring test tools and click 'Execute'. This automated test method can improve the efficiency of this UDS protocol stack test, and reduce the workload of developers.

Copyright
© 2016, the Authors. Published by Atlantis Press.
Open Access
This is an open access article distributed under the CC BY-NC license (http://creativecommons.org/licenses/by-nc/4.0/).

Download article (PDF)

Volume Title
Proceedings of the 2016 5th International Conference on Measurement, Instrumentation and Automation (ICMIA 2016)
Series
Advances in Intelligent Systems Research
Publication Date
November 2016
ISBN
10.2991/icmia-16.2016.113
ISSN
1951-6851
DOI
10.2991/icmia-16.2016.113How to use a DOI?
Copyright
© 2016, the Authors. Published by Atlantis Press.
Open Access
This is an open access article distributed under the CC BY-NC license (http://creativecommons.org/licenses/by-nc/4.0/).

Cite this article

TY  - CONF
AU  - Jinghua Yu
AU  - Feng Luo
PY  - 2016/11
DA  - 2016/11
TI  - An Automated Testing Method for UDS Protocol Stack of Vehicles
BT  - Proceedings of the 2016 5th International Conference on Measurement, Instrumentation and Automation (ICMIA 2016)
PB  - Atlantis Press
SN  - 1951-6851
UR  - https://doi.org/10.2991/icmia-16.2016.113
DO  - 10.2991/icmia-16.2016.113
ID  - Yu2016/11
ER  -